Steam generator and heating cooker comprising steam generator

A steam generator comprises a water storage chamber which stores water, a steam generating heater which heats water in the water storage chamber, a water supply pump which supplies water stored in a water supply tank through a water supply port provided in the water storage chamber and a water supply passage, a discharge passage which discharges water formed with a first water discharge passage having a U shape to be convex downward, which is in fluid communication with a discharge port provided in the water storage chamber, and a second water discharge passage having an inverted U shape to be convex upward, and configured such that water stored in the water storage chamber is discharged through the discharge port and the water discharge passage according to the theory of a siphon, wherein the first water discharge passage is formed by a nonmetallic material.

Combination oven with peak power control

A commercial oven, such as a combination oven providing steam and convection heating, may provide for two different peak power modes and for steam cooking. A temperature sensor sampling temperature from a region of the oven may be used to detect a complete filling of the oven with steam. The temperature of the temperature sensor is compared against different temperature thresholds depending on the selected peak power so that temperature may be used to discriminate steam filling for different peak power levels.

FOOD PROCESSOR AND INSERT RECEPTACLE FOR ARRANGEMENT IN A FOOD PROCESSOR

A food processor, in particular a mixing device, comprising a housing for accommodating a receptacle and a cover that closes the receptacle, and a locking mechanism for interlocking the receptacle with the cover; the locking mechanism includes a locking element, especially a locking roller, which can be moved relative to the receptacle and/or the cover from an unlocking position into a locking position and vice versa. In order to further develop food processors of the type, the locking element, apart from or in addition to interlocking the receptacle with the cover, is designed to have a subsidiary effect on the receptacle and/or the cover or to subsidiarily interact with the receptacle and/or the cover.

Device for cleaning, storing or cooking objects

An apparatus for cleaning, storing or cooking items includes a housing formed by walls enclosing an internal space; at least one support arrangement removable from the housing; and at least one locking unit arranged at the support arrangement. The support arrangement includes at least one rail system having at least two rails connected together and moveable relative to each other and at least one support element. The locking unit includes at least one locking element which can be transferred between a blocking position and a free position, wherein, when the support arrangement is mounted to the housing, the locking unit is in its free state in which the locking element enables extension of the rail system. When the support arrangement is separated from the housing, the locking unit is in its blocking state in which the locking element blocks extension of the rail system with the formation of a positively locking relationship.

Steam heating boiler

The present invention is to provide a steam heating boiler, which can be implemented by combining steam table and steam cabinet; said boiler includes a hollow upper groove thereabove and a hollow bottom groove therebelow; the top opening of said upper groove is sealed, and the volume of the hollow bottom groove protruded downwardly from the lower part of the said upper groove, the upper part of said bottom groove communicated with the lower part of the upper groove, and the lower part of said bottom groove is sealed, so that water can flow freely inside the upper groove and bottom groove.

Steam cooking apparatus

A steam cooking apparatus includes a steam generating unit to generate steam from a supply of water, a steam container to cook food using the steam from the steam generating unit, a steam supply pipe coupled to the steam generating unit in order to supply the steam container with the steam generated by the steam generating unit, a steam pipe coupled to the steam container in order to supply the steam container with the steam passing through the steam supply pipe, and a steam pipe connection tube including a first connection portion coupled with the steam supply pipe and a second connection portion coupled with the steam pipe, the second connection portion coupled with the steam pipe being formed to have a diameter which is expanded toward the steam pipe so as to guide the steam pipe.

Steamer container system

A steamer container system is provided having a container body, a lid assembly and a steamer basket. The lid assembly is removably connected to the container body to close the opening to the cavity of the container body. The lid assembly includes a vent aperture and a vent tab having a protrusion extending therefrom that is adapted to engage and selectively close the vent aperture. The lid assembly may also have a viewing window to view the food being cooked in the container. The steamer basket is sized to fit within the cavity of the container body for cooking food thereon.
